Lucknow: Encouraged by the enactment of a law against triple talaq, Muslim women in Varanasi have sent  Rakhi to MPs from their area and the country's PM Narendra Modi. While some Muslim maulanas have lauded this noble cause, some have termed it as a "cheap propaganda". Opponents said the RSS' subsidiary, the Muslim platform, is doing such a thing.

"The way PM Modi put an end to the practice of triple talaq, he can only do one brother," says Rakhi-making Muslim women. For our brother, we sisters are making rakhi in our hands. A picture of PM Modi has been put on top of Rakhi. "Modiji has put an end to our pathetic situation. Even the upcoming women can avoid the havoc of triple talaq. That is why we sent this holy bond to Rakhi. '

Rama Bano of Ramapura, who makes Rakhi, said, "Prime Minister Modi put an end to the practice of triple talaq. Narendra Modi is the prime minister of the country and an MP for Varanasi Lok Sabha seat as well as elder brother of all Muslim women in the country. We sisters have made rakhi for our brother. She said that the good work that has been done so far will continue.
